My son and I were there. We got unit 3. Saw 1 buck and a couple does and a fawn. Found a couple spots that looked good. Was a hot day for scouting though. Lots of hills in unit 3 and a couple of creeks with some pretty good drop offs. I hate I am going to have to drive through all those other sections to get to mine but the way the roads are it's the only choice you have. Justkeep that in mind if you are planning a morning hunt on one of those fields near the road. Unit 3 is gonna be tricky to hunt with a youth and a rifle. Decent unit for a bow hunter. Really hope they get that new plot finished and planted. Turkey247 I can tell you a great spot to take a kid in unit 3. Found it when we were there last year. Also, that yellow jacket plot in unit 3 doesn't exist so don't waste your time walking all the way there. Feel free to shoot me a PM if you want.
